Cherry Blossom Photoshoot at the Tidal Basin, DC

Pale pink petals framing the Jefferson Memorial is the most-wanted photo in Washington, and the hardest to time. Here’s how it works:

Bloom timing swings with late-winter temperatures, and forecasts aren’t reliable more than about ten days out, so book flexible dates and watch the NPS updates.

Where to stand

The Jefferson Memorial across the water

The classic frame: blossoms in the foreground, the dome behind. The Tidal Basin’s east side works best in early light.

The MLK Memorial & West Basin Drive

Blossoms against sculpted stone, with a bit more breathing room than the main loop.

East Potomac Park (Hains Point)

The locals’ answer to the crowds, the same trees, a fraction of the people, and it blooms slightly later.

💡 Local tip: Go at sunrise. The Tidal Basin loop is shoulder-to-shoulder by mid-morning during peak bloom, and the early light on pale pink petals is the best of the day anyway.

If you miss peak bloom, don’t panic; the trees look beautiful for several days on either side of the official peak, later-blooming varieties extend the season, and petal drop creates a pink carpet that photographs wonderfully.

FAQ

When is peak bloom in Washington DC? Usually the last week of March into early April. NPS issues a forecast in late February and updates it weekly.

Where can I photograph cherry blossoms without crowds? East Potomac Park at Hains Point — the same trees as the Tidal Basin with a fraction of the visitors.
